Geoff was co-founder of Gare Du Nord Theatre in 2016. His event management skills include the organisation of fundraising events, mini-festivals and numerous social enterprises throughout his academic, work, charitable and community involvement over the years. Credited with co-founding the Change the Lives UK charity, helping vulnerable children who live on the Railways in Bangladesh. Closer to home a partnership with The Bee Sanctuary Movement and Avanti West Coast has led to numerous successful sustainability events in Manchester.

Geoff – Co-founder, writer, performer, producer and director.
Geoff started in amateur dramatic theatre in 2009. Over the past 15 years his attention turned from actor to choreographer, producer, writer, director and more recently as a committee member as Backstage Manager for The Didsbury Players ADS.
In his spare time, he enjoys travelling and organising events via the largest online travel community : Couchsurfing, where he was appointed Ambassador from 2011.
His love of music , hiking, cycling and outdoor pursuits always keeps him on his toes, when he’s not preparing for the next upcoming show.
Geoff is our current chairperson.
